Steven Weisler
Steven Weisler, professor of linguistics, obtained his Ph.D. from Stanford and was a Sloan post-doctoral fellow in cognitive science at the University of Massachusetts Amherst. He also holds an M.A. in communication from Case Western Reserve University.
His is founder and director of Hampshire’s Innovative Instruction Laboratory, which explores educational applications of multimedia technology, and has produced for MIT Press a CD-ROM edition of Theory of Language. He is co-author of the 1987 and 1995 editions of Cognitive Science: An Introduction, the first undergraduate textbook in the field.
His main interests lie in semantics, syntax, language acquisition, and the philosophy of language.
